General Purpose and Scope of Position: The Technical Nutrition Associate (TNA) is responsible for supporting the Technical Nutrition Agronomist in the Inland Empire District of Wilbur-Ellis (Eastern Washington and Southwestern Idaho). As the Technical Nutrition Associate, you will assist in developing sound crop nutritional strategies through data collection and data analysis in Total Nutrition System (TNS), Ag Verdict, and

Probe Schedule. You will also work with Crop Advisors, and customers within a specific geography; specifically, focusing on proper product selection and use based on agronomic needs.

Specific Responsibilities : Develop and utilize precision agricultural tools with an emphasis on nutrition and yield data analysis Develop/optimize existing value-added nutritional offerings Collaborate with the Inland Empire Field Development Team in the evaluation of nutritional products, bio-stimulants, and seed treatments Work with Technical Nutrition Agronomists and Key Account Managers to help identify new key customers, understand their business, determine their needs, and develop nutritional plans

Work as a team member in the analysis and optimization of the Wilbur-Ellis nutritional database Assist Location Sales Managers in optimizing growth in our nutritional segment and profitability for the territories Assist Technical Nutrition Agronomist in implementing nutritional marketing and sales plans; establish and meet R&D goals; and network with industry representatives, sales staff, and branded product personnel to expand sales opportunities Build product and market knowledge to add understanding and credibility Become the primary contact between customers and Wilbur-Ellis field staff in developing and executing an integrated nutritional strategy that optimizes our customer's goals.

Strictly follow all company policies which include safety & regulatory Participate in industry grower meetings, promoting sound science and the Wilbur-Ellis database of nutritional offerings and strategies Skills and Qualifications Needed : Master's degree in soil science, or agronomy crop production. Understanding of Precision Agricultural tools and GIS technologies Strong Data analytical skills using statistics, spreadsheets, and databases Extremely goal-oriented with long-term project vision Display a " curiosity" mindset to establishing solutions to on-farm issues Demonstrate excellent written and oral communication skills to small and large groups with an ability to lead and influence Detail and accuracy-oriented with an 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ously Good interpersonal and team-building skills with the ability to establish relationships with field personnel, peers, and customers Ability to work independently with minimum supervision Ability to travel throughout the region and overnight Physically able to endure outdoor climates including inclement weather Skills and Qualifications Preferred : 3 years of experience in agriculture research and development preferred Knowledge of agricultural production and sound soil science Knowledge of fertilizers (dry and liquid) Compensation and Benefits: In compliance with all states and cities requiring transparency of pay, the base compensation for this position ranges from $62,500 - $83,370.
